Key trends driving demand: Remote work and BYOD -- more teams require mobile-first telephony rather than desk phones, increasing demand for smartphone-capable routing.; Programmable voice APIs -- Twilio-style APIs and SIP trunking lower time-to-market for custom routing and PSTN fallback.; Native OS call integration -- iOS CallKit and Android ConnectionService allow VoIP apps to behave like native calls, improving reliability and UX.; Cloud contact center growth -- rising adoption of cloud contact tools pushes buyers away from legacy PBX toward SaaS routing solutions..
Key competitors include RingCentral, Aircall, Twilio Programmable Voice, Grasshopper / GoTo Connect (SMB virtual phone services), Carrier call forwarding and native mobile workarounds.
